Understanding Vaping

Vaping involves inhaling vapor produced by a device, commonly known as a vaporizer or vape pen. The vapor is generated by heating a liquid known as e-liquid or vape juice. This liquid often contains nicotine, flavorings, and other chemicals that produce a vapor cloud when heated. The flexible nature of vaping devices allows users to customize their experience with various flavors and nicotine concentrations. Unlike traditional smoking, vaping involves no combustion, thus potentially reducing the inhalation of harmful substances typically present in cigarette smoke.

Decoding E-Cigarettes

E-cigarettes, short for electronic cigarettes, mimic the look and feel of a traditional cigarette. They are generally pre-filled with a liquid mixture and have a more straightforward design compared to advanced vaping devices. These products are often considered a stepping stone for smokers transitioning away from conventional tobacco products due to their familiarity and ease of use.

The Core Differences

  • Design and Customization: Vaping devices often feature advanced options for customization, allowing adjustments in wattage, flavored e-liquids, and nicotine levels. Conversely, e-cigarettes are usually pre-configured and offer less flexibility.
  • Device Complexity: Vaporizers tend to be more complex, with rebuildable coils and tanks, attracting enthusiasts who enjoy tinkering with their devices. E-cigarettes focus on simplicity and ease of use.

  • Cost and Maintenance: While initial setup costs for vaping might be higher due to device acquisition, long-term costs favor vapes as liquid refills can be more economical than continuously purchasing disposable e-cigarettes.

The Benefits of Vaping

One key benefit of vaping is its harm reduction potential. By eliminating the combustion process, users avoid inhaling tar and many carcinogens found in tobacco smoke. Furthermore, vaping presents a social benefit due to the variety of non-intrusive flavors that minimize the unwanted smell associated with smoking.

Advantages of E-Cigarettes

E-cigarettes offer simplicity and convenience, making them a favored choice for new users and transitioning smokers. Their discreet size and ease of use make them more accessible, presenting fewer barriers to those not wishing to engage in technical device operation.
